gb-70 Posted November 12, 2020 Share Posted November 12, 2020 The App is only available in English and Korean language. If the App does not find a supported language on the phone it will use its default, Korean. On the iPhone settings (not in the App) you will have to choose English as the second language. So first may be German, Dutch or another one and second must be English. Than remove the App and install it again. The App will use the first language in the list on your iPhone that it supports. In this case it will show up in English. Works fine for me, the App is really cool! Hope it helps! Vincent1234 1 Link to comment

Popular Post gb-70 Posted November 12, 2020 Popular Post Share Posted November 12, 2020 I don´t know if this is dependent on the iOS-version, but you can select additional languages in iOS. You don´t have to replace your language. My phone is still in German, only the Aurender App is in English. It is just about the order of preferred langauges: Vincent1234 and marslo 2 Link to comment

Popular Post The Computer Audiophile Posted November 18, 2020 Popular Post Share Posted November 18, 2020 7 hours ago, Deyorew said: About 3 and a half years ago I asked a question in this thread about sorting albums by artist chronologically. The responses were all saying Conductor app didn’t have that capability (which really shocked me) but was constantly improving. Well should I assume albums chronological is a way to sort now? In other words Abbey Road (1969) is shown after Sgt Pepper (1967)? Or is it still A-Z? I agree that this method of sorting is really nice. In a way, it's like sorting an album by track number. nobody would think of NOT sorting by track number. Albums usually show an artists progression through one's career and people are used to the flow from one album to the next when browsing. Using alphabetical is logical, but not for something like art that is released in a sequence and often the art references moments in time around when it was created. I would love this to be added to aurender. I believe the issue is making sure the date tags are correct. However, if users are given the choice for sorting, if they didn't have date tags they wouldn't have to use this method. Or, they could add the tags. @AriMargolis What say you? 7 hours ago, Deyorew said: album art....
